I YELLOW butterflies Over the blossoming virgin corn, With pollen-painted faces Chase one another in brilliant throng. 2 Blue butterflies Over the blossoming virgin beans, With pollen-painted faces Chase one another in brilliant streams. 3 Over the blossoming corn, Over the virgin corn Wild bees hum; Over the blossoming corn, Over the virgin beans Wild bees hum. 4 Over your field of growing corn All day shall hang the thunder-cloud; Over your field of growing corn All day shall come the rushing rain.
